      Brianne Beebe do you have a preference on how notes are taken like the worksheet that you put into your notebooks, do you have them fill in the blanks or do you give them it filled out already and they have to write out an example? Do you use astro bright paper or colored pencils or highlighters, what's your favorite way to add color to the notebook ?...... Did that make sense 😕😣

    • @BusyMissBeebe
      @BusyMissBeebe  6 років тому

      SweetDee101 Thank you for clarifying. Most of my notes are fill-ins to save time. They have to write in keywords and show work on the examples. I used to use colored paper, but students preferred white paper because the highlighter colors looked funny on colored paper. We use highlighters and colored pencil to add color.
